Wagglepop 2: Deja Vu as Auction Site That Left Sellers Stranded Reopens


You're invited to the Grand Re-Opening of Wagglepoop!

Everyone receiving this invitation is one of the thousands of people who showed interest in and support for our desire to provide a real and lasting online auction alternative.

As many of you know, we made just about every mistake possible during our first launch, and the original Wagglepoop was closed just a week after its initial debut.

On a personal note, I cannot express enough how deeply saddened I was at that time by our inability to provide what so many of you had supported, and what we had promised. The many supportive emails we received subsequent to our closing served not only to punctuate our belief that an online auction alternative was needed, but that our resolve to accomplish such a task needed to be stronger and more dedicated.

Ultimately, as founder of Wagglepoop, I accept all responsibility for the failure of our initial attempt. I also offer my sincerest apology to all who supported us, promoted us, and believed in us. Not a single day has gone by since that I have not worked to honor your faith in the idea of Wagglepop, and to bring a new version to market that is everything you expect and deserve.

This invitation and the new version of Wagglepoop are the fulfillment of that promise from a little over one year ago.

We are confident we have made all of the adjustments necessary to provide a viable alternative marketplace by consulting and contracting with industry experts in both the hardware and software departments, and feel confident that we have created a site that is not only viable, but offers some exciting and innovative features not found anywhere else.

Features like the Red Carpet Customer Program, Buy More Now, DynamicDiscounts, and Wagglepoop Stores featuring BusinessBuilder are just a few of the features or ideas that we think can help change the ways in which buyers and sellers trade, and build relationships.

We think you'll find Wagglepoop to be familiar in the ways that you've come to like and expect, yet fresh and exciting in the ways that count most.

The new Wagglepoop is a 100% trust-based community, and requires no financial information to participate as a seller or buyer.

We would be honored if you would visit us at www.wagglepoop.com to learn more about Wagglepoop, and further honored to have you as a member.

Wagglepoop is for everyone who believed, and believes still, that it is possible to take a stand, and make a difference.

Together, we can change everything.

- Raymond M. Romeo
CEO - Wagglepoop

RE: Wagglepop 2: Deja Vu as Auction Site That Left Sellers Stranded Reopens
Todd was right that something was up. He emailed  me a few months ago to say that he was getting  an authorization required password box when he tried to access the Wagglepop domain and thought something was up because it pointed towards an auction on the cgi-bin rather than the old Windows auction path  :blinkie:

For your information, the new Wagglepop is using RScript: http://www.rscript.com/demo/Auction
